The Minister of Foreign Affairs travels to Israel to participate in the Trilateral Meeting of the Ministers of Foreign Affairs of Cyprus, Israel and Greece

The Minister of Foreign Affairs, Mr Nikos Christodoulides, travels to Israel on Sunday morning (22/8) in order to take part in tomorrow’s Cyprus-Israel-Greece Trilateral Meeting, together with his counterparts from the two countries, Mr Yair Lapid and Mr Nikos Dendias, respectively.This is the first meeting between the three countries at the level of Foreign Ministers since the new Israeli government took office, reaffirming the common will of all parties to further develop their cooperation...

Joint Search and Rescue Exercise between Cyprus and Greece “SALAMIS 04-21”

A joint Search and Rescue exercise between Cyprus and Greece called "SALAMIS – 04/21" was conducted today, Friday, 20th August 2021, within the Search and Rescue region of the Republic of Cyprus, with the participation of the Hellenic ship "SALAMIS", a helicopter of the 460th Search and Rescue Squadron of the National Guard, as well as specialized nurses of the Ambulance Services.The exercise is part of the existing bilateral agreement between Cyprus and Greece, it is the 4th in 2021, and wa...

Turnover Value Index of Transport and Storage: 2nd Quarter 2021

Annual Change +15,6%The Turnover Value Index of Transport and Storage for the second quarter of 2021 reached 88,2 units (base year 2015=100), recording an increase of 15,6% compared to the corresponding quarter of 2020.By economic activity, increases relative to the second quarter of the previous year were observed in air transport by 327,1%, in land transport by 46,4%, in water transport by 30,3% and in warehousing and support activities for transportation by 10,1%, while a decrease of 2,5...

The 2021 results of the Palaepaphos Urban Landscape Project(PULP 2006-2021), University of Cyprus

The Department of Antiquities, Cyprus, of the Ministry of Transport, Communications and Works announces that between the 17th May and the 30th June 2021 the Archaeological Research Unit of the University of Cyprus conducted its 16th mission, within the framework of thePalaepaphos Urban Landscape Project, which has been running since 2006 under the direction of Professor Maria Iakovou.   The 2021 excavations focused on the monumental workshop complex that was identified running along the nort...
